What is principal of tablet hardness and friability?

The principle of tablet hardness is to measure the tablets' resistance to breaking or chipping under pressure, which is important for assessing their mechanical strength. The principle of tablet friability is to measure the tablets' tendency to break or crumble when subjected to mechanical stress during handling or storage, serving as an indicator of their robustness and quality. Both tests are crucial in assessing the physical properties of tablets for formulation and manufacturing.

What is ideal hardness for tablet?

The ideal hardness for a tablet is typically between 4 to 8 kg (kilogram-force) as measured by a tablet hardness tester. This range ensures that the tablet is durable enough to withstand handling and transportation without breaking, while also allowing it to disintegrate properly when taken orally.


What is correlation between tablet hardness unit N and Kp?

Tablet hardness is a measure of the force required to break a tablet, typically in units of N (Newton). Kp (kiloponds) is a unit of force as well. There is a direct correlation between tablet hardness in N and Kp, as they both measure force, with 1 Kp equaling 9.80665 N.


How can you increase tablet hardness without changing formulation?

Increasing tablet hardness without changing the formulation can be achieved by adjusting the compression force during tablet manufacturing. By increasing the compression force, the particles in the formulation will be more tightly packed together, resulting in harder tablets. What is the formula to calculate friability?

friability F=I-F.100/I where I =Iinitial weight of tablets , F = weight after friability. Normal limit less than 1%.

What materials commonly used as bonding agents in grinding wheels?

It depends on how friable the final wheel is to be. Binders can be synthetic or natural resins, mineral cements or glasses, in order of increasing hardness, decreasing friability.
